This week the group sat down and we put together a list of a few of our favorite things. This week? Mexican restaurants. Of course we all know that Texas has a pretty decent collection of authentic and Tex-Mex restaurants all over the state, and we’ve got a list of our top five favorite restaurants […more]
Posted in: Dallas
Comments are closed.